From: Pavel Begunkov Date: Mon, 10 Nov 2025 13:03:53 +0000 (+0000) Subject: io_uring/query: return number of available queries X-Git-Tag: v6.18-rc6~22^2~1 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=6a77267d97b5b6cd0e35099ab4eb054e5f965ee6;p=thirdparty%2Flinux.git io_uring/query: return number of available queries It's useful to know which query opcodes are available. Extend the structure and return that. It's a trivial change, and even though it can be painlessly extended later, it'd still require adding a v2 of the structure.
